    US says war set to run on as Ukraine prepares to ratify minerals deal | Russia-Ukraine war News

    DaveBy DaveMay 2, 2025No Comments3 Mins Read
    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it Telegram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email


    Washington-Kyiv deal absolves Ukraine of previous ‘debt’ for support, however doesn’t give safety ensures in opposition to additional Russian aggression.

    United States Vice President JD Vance has stated his administration sees no finish to the battle in Ukraine, regardless of preparations in Kyiv to ratify a minerals deal with Washington.

    Vance instructed Fox Information on Thursday that the Ukraine battle prompted by Russia’s invasion of the nation in 2022 was “not going to finish any time quickly”.

    The feedback got here a day after Ukraine signed a deal granting the US precedence entry to its minerals, which, though it stopped wanting providing safety ensures, has raised hopes in Kyiv and Europe that US assist might be revived and Ukrainian safety elevated.

    “It’s going to be as much as them to come back to an settlement and cease this brutal, brutal battle,” Vance stated within the interview, referring to Russia and Ukraine. “It’s not going wherever … It’s not going to finish any time quickly.”

    Ukrainian legislator Yaroslav Zheleznyak stated on Telegram on Friday that parliament would vote on Might 8 to ratify the minerals deal.

    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y insisted on Thursday that the deal, which was virtually derailed after a fiery alternate with Vance and President Donald Trump in February, was “a very equal settlement”.

    The deal absolves Ukraine from earlier US calls for that it cowl the reimbursement of billions of {dollars} in navy support equipped by Washington since Russia invaded in February 2022.

    It doesn’t give any particular US safety commitments, as Ukraine was in search of. Nonetheless, Washington argues that boosting US enterprise pursuits in Ukraine would assist deter Russia.

    ‘Nonetheless far aside’

    Trump has insisted that he’ll dealer a ceasefire, however his administration has warned that it may stroll away ought to Russia and Ukraine proceed to launch assaults on one another.

    US Secretary of State Marco Rubio instructed Fox Information on Thursday that the 2 nations have been “nearer, however they’re nonetheless far aside”.

    In the meantime, hostilities persist. The Ukrainian air power stated on Friday that Russia launched 150 drones in a single day.

    Strikes on the commercial metropolis of Zaporizhzhia left 29 folks wounded, in accordance with regional Governor Ivan Fedorov, writing on Telegram.

    Two males have been wounded in a drone assault within the japanese Dnipropetrovsk area, with fires breaking out at two places, Governor Sergiy Lysak stated on Telegram.

    Russia’s Ministry of Defence stated its air defences destroyed 121 Ukrainian drones, the bulk over Crimea, the Black Sea peninsula which Russia annexed in 2014.
